> Three RC bugs are listed for src:aboot, with at least partial
> solutions for two of them.
> 
> 1/ This last one is #949711 about the build-dep 'sgmltool-lite' soon 
> removed from the archive. 'sgmltools' from package 'sgmltool-lite' 
> is run at line 7 of file doc/faq/Makefile (only ocurrence as far 
> as I can see)
>                     sgmltools --backend=html SRM-HOWTO.sgml
> The package 'docbook-utils' is a build dependency of aboot yet
> and includes docbook2html.
> $ docbook2html SRM-HOWTO.sgml
> succeeded for me (at least on amd64 running stretch). Does it 
> make sense to patch the source of aboot accordingly ?

Yes, I'm aware of that. I have already verified that myself yesterday.

In the long-term, it would make more sense though to convert the SGML
files to XML.

> In a farther future, do we want to keep a source in Docbook SGML ?

No.

> 2/ The current maintainer mentioned [1] that aboot needs to produce an
> arch:all package (aboot-base) on arch:alpha. See bug #805988 (and #821332). 
> However, it should be possible to cross-build aboot, as suggesteed by
> the current maintainer [2] (at that time, I managed to cross-build aboot 
> on amd64 and I booted successfully a real AlphaWorkstation 500 with it : 
> see [3] and the followings. I haven't tested with current sid since). 
> However, the patches should be cleaned and I never managed to find the time (sorry).

I don't think we necessarily have to cross-compile everything, but I haven't
decided yet.

Please note that we addressed a very similar issue in src:palo and solved
it by cross-compiling.

> 3/ And #832491 about the build dep 'sp' removed, with two patches included.

What patches? For "sp", we can also just use "docbook2man" from docbook-utils,
I already verified that.

> And a ':native' annotation added to the build dep opensp is required as 
> well in order to cross-build (or solve #854518).

I don't want to use opensp but just docbook-utils only.
